The Sharjah Centre for Astronomy and Space Sciences (SCASS) has announced the likely date for Eid Al Adha this year.
In a brief statement issued online, the centre again announced likely dates for Ramadan and Eid Al Fitr in 2018, reported Sharjah News.
Eid Al Adha is expected to begin on August 22 (Wednesday), which translates to a long weekend for people in UAE as 'historically', the government announces a four-day break for the public sector and a three-day break for the private sector.
Therefore, with Eid Al Adha falling on a Wednesday this year, residents could enjoy a four-day long holiday.
